TRICONEX 3613E TMR Supervised 115VAC Sinking Digital Output Module
Description
Model Interpretation
3613E:8Ch isolated sink supervised 115VAC TMR DO; E=enhanced diagnostic upgrade version; dedicated mating terminal 3613R; sink AC design vs sourcing AC counterpart 3611E, differs from 24VDC transistor/relay output series.
Technical Parameters
Electrical Spec
Channel:8 fully isolated non-common sink AC output
Rated input field:115VAC(90~132VAC,50/60Hz)
Per channel continuous load:0.5A, surge 3.5A/10ms; min load ≥25mA to support open/break wire diagnosis
Off-state leakage ≤3.5mA; independent channel fast fuse on 3613R base
Field-backplane isolation:2000VAC galvanic isolation
Backplane power draw ≤11.2W, built-in auto-recovery short protection
Safety & Redundancy
Architecture:TMR 2-out-of-3 hardware median voting, single branch fault no spurious shutdown or false energization
Certification:IEC61508 SIL3, TÜV, UL, CE, FM, ATEX
Diagnostics:per-channel continuous load monitoring + periodic pulse test to detect short/open circuit/cable break; fault coverage>99.9%
SOE timestamp ≤40ms; MTBF>131000H
Mechanical & Environment
Single slot 3U module; dimension:114×30×185mm; weight≈1.13kg; cream front panel
Operating:-40℃~+70℃; storage:-55℃~+85℃; humidity 5%~95%RH non-condensing
Front LED:PASS, FAULT, ACTIVE, LOAD
Core Functions
Sink-type 115VAC safety driving for critical AC shutdown solenoid and safety relay; periodic pulse inspection verifies field circuit integrity without accidental valve switching; TMR redundant design meets SIL3 safety specification; online hot swap without SIS stop; real-time fault alarm uploaded to TriStation engineering software.
Applications
Oil&gas onshore/offshore 115VAC ESD shutdown solenoid control; refinery HIPPS AC isolation valve drive; petrochemical flare emergency interlock output; power plant boiler/turbine AC trip relay control; F&G fire suppression AC actuator loop.
